(Sonny) John C. Goldizen Jr passed away at his home on the morning of 12/31/25.
He was valued member of his community as he was a former business owner of Kelley's Trim Shop and the only Kenton County Marshal to have served in the state of Kentucky in the 60's. He observed Catholic religion. He wasn't a religious man but he was right with god. He raised his children to observe god in the Baptist Church.
He was one of 12 Children to father John C Goldizen Sr and mother Mary Goldizen of St Joseph, Missouri. He is proceeded in death by 4 brothers and 6 sisters.
He also proceeded in death by ex wife Patricia A Goldizen.
He is survived by his youngest brother (Shorty) David Goldizen and his longtime girlfriend Patricia Rodgers.
He was also has 5 sons (Jay) John C Goldizen III spouse Margret Goldizen of Kansas, Scott A Goldizen spouse Cindy Goldizen of FtWright Ky Timmy L Goldizen spouse Stacy Goldizen of Erlanger, Ky, Alvin Keith Goldizen spouse Linda Goldizen of Richwood,Ky Larry A Goldizen of Florence, Ky and 1 daughter Tina Goldizen of Ft Worth, Tx. He had 15 grandchildren and 11 great grandchildren.
He loved building high performance cars and passed all that knowledge onto his children. All of his boys are all in the automotive field as that's how they were raised. He cherished his treasured bright yellow and white pearl 1955 Chevrolet. Anyone that he ever met was a friend to him. He had no enemies in this world and was loved by everyone who knew him. He will be missed by all his family and friends.

Place of birth: St Joseph, MO
Most recently lived in: Fiskburg, KY
John's favorite hobbies: He loved working on cars, building hot rods and doing auto body work. He was an avid drag racer when he was younger
John's favorite foods: He loved Spam, fried potatoes and jalapeño peppers
Favorite bands and musical artists: He loved to listen to Elivis Presley and old Country Music
Interesting facts about John: He was an amazing auto mechanic. He was a professional custom exhaust pipe bender. He used to custom bend exhaust systems for cars and even made it into the newspapers many years ago for his work. He once custom bent the exhaust system on the original Batmobile for custom car builder George Barris. He was also a very talented auto body man. He had painted many cars over that were show winners @ Cavalcade of Customs He was the one and only Kenton County Marshal ever in the state of Ky He was a record time holder @ Thornhill Dragstrip until 1994
John loved nothing more than: Talk to people. He was a people person. He could meet a complete stranger and talk to them for hours. He loved to work on his 1955 Chevy. He loved his pets and his dog Duke
Favorite place in the world: He loved to go home to St Joseph, Missouri and see family.
John's profession(s): Auto Body mechanic, beer truck driver, Kenton County Marshal, Auto Mechanic
Favorite sports: He loved NASCAR and Drag Racing
John's superpower: He could carry on a complete conversation with someone with his cigar in his mouth and mumble the whole time. Somehow you knew what he was saying and meant.
